According to a recent LinkedIn post from PetScreening, the company is marking its ninth year of providing documentation and compliance tools for pets and assistance animals in rental housing. The post highlights a focus on consistency, transparency, and adapting to an evolving regulatory environment while working with what it describes as forward-thinking housing providers.

The post suggests that PetScreening has concentrated on balancing risk management with empathy, and on simplifying complex processes for property managers and residents. For investors, this emphasis may indicate a continued strategy of differentiation through compliance expertise and user experience, factors that could support client retention and recurring revenue.
As shared in the post, the company underscores the role of its clients, partners, and communities in shaping its evolution and culture. This framing points to a partnership-driven growth model in the rental housing ecosystem, which could help deepen integration with property management workflows and potentially increase switching costs over time.
The post also signals that PetScreening intends to keep iterating on its platform and services, emphasizing curiosity and ongoing improvement nine years into its trajectory. Sustained investment in product development and regulatory adaptation may position the company to benefit from continued pet-inclusivity trends in multifamily housing, though the post does not provide quantitative metrics or specific financial guidance.
